Как цифровые продукты проходят проверку качества

Актуальная разработка программного обеспечения немыслима без системной структуры контроля стандартов. Любой сутки миллионы пользователей взаимодействуют с разнообразными сервисами, интернет-платформами и цифровыми продуктами, предполагая от них стабильной функциональности, безопасности и соответствия описанному возможностям. Процесс поддержания надежности технических решений составляет собой комплексную систему тестирования, проверки и мониторинга, которая сопровождает продукт на любом этапах его жизненного цикла.

Что конкретно понимают надежностью в цифровых решениях

Качество программного обеспечения Драгон мани казино устанавливается множеством критериев, которые в комплексе определяют пользовательский взаимодействие и системную надежность разработки. Функциональность составляет главным параметром – система призвана осуществлять все объявленные опции в согласии с системными требованиями и надеждами юзеров.

Устойчивость технического продукта проявляется в его умении работать без ошибок в разнообразных условиях применения. Это содержит стабильность к внезапным входным данным, правильную работу неверных условий и возможность возобновляться после краткосрочных проблем. Эффективность показывает быстроту выполнения действий, период ответа системы на пользовательские команды и эффективность задействования компьютерных ресурсов.

Простота применения устанавливает, как доступным и удобным представляется взаимодействие с системой для финальных пользователей. Сюда относятся эргономичность взаимодействия Драгон мани казино, понятность управления, открытость для людей с ограниченными потребностями и общая доступность освоения функционала.

Обслуживаемость технического программирования воздействует на возможность его дальнейшего совершенствования и сопровождения. Качественно написанный программа должен быть доступным, структурированным, качественно документированным и упорядоченным так, чтобы прочие разработчики могли без труда в нем разобраться и добавить требуемые корректировки.

Как проверяют, что каждое функционирует по спецификациям

Контроль соответствия цифрового решения требованиям стартует с скрупулезного исследования спецификаций и операционных условий. Отдел контроля создает подробные тест-кейсы, которые покрывают все описанные в документации варианты применения системы Драгон мани. Каждый случай содержит четкие действия для повторения, предполагаемые итоги и критерии успешного прохождения тестирования.

Матрица отслеживаемости условий содействует проверить, что любое требование покрыто релевантными испытаниями, а любой тест ассоциирован с определенным параметром. Это позволяет исключить обстоятельств, когда существенная функциональность оказывается непроверенной или когда тратится время на контроль несуществующих требований.

Финальное испытание проводится с участием покупателей или представителей отделов, которые наиболее точно знают, как программа обязана функционировать в действительных обстоятельствах. Они тестируют не только технологическую правильность воплощения, но и соответствие деловым операциям и потребительским ожиданиям.

Регрессионное тестирование гарантирует, что свежие модификации в программе не нарушили предварительно действовавший функционал. После любого обновления или исправления ошибок запускается набор проверок, проверяющих основные возможности системы.

Почему контроль начинается еще до написания скрипта

Нынешний способ к гарантированию стандартов предполагает деятельное привлечение экспертов по тестированию на начальных этапах проекта:

  • Изучение требований позволяет обнаружить неточности, противоречия и упущения в системных условиях до начала программирования.
  • Разработка контрольных случаев помогает качественнее осознать планируемое работу программы и конкретизировать детали реализации.
  • Формирование контрольных материалов и испытательной инфраструктуры сохраняет ресурс на последующих стадиях.
  • Планирование методологии контроля устанавливает требуемые ресурсы и временные рамки для качественной контроля.
  • Формирование автоматизированных проверок может начинаться синхронно с программированием главного программы.

Подобный подход, известный как “сдвиг влево” в тестировании, заметно сокращает цену коррекции ошибок, поскольку их нахождение и устранение на начальных этапах нуждается минимальных расходов периода и средств. Помимо этого, преждевременное вовлечение специалистов в деятельность помогает созданию общего восприятия разработки у целой команды разработки Dragon Money.

Какие виды контроля применяют: ручным способом и механически

Ручное испытание остается незаменимым способом для проверки пользовательского опыта, исследовательского тестирования и тестирования многоуровневых рабочих ситуаций. Тестировщики реализуют задачу конечных пользователей, взаимодействуя с системой через пользовательский взаимодействие и оценивая удобство использования, логичность функционирования и соответствие ожиданиям.

Поисковое испытание дает возможность обнаружить непредвиденные дефекты и проблемы, которые не были учтены в стандартных сценариях. Квалифицированные тестировщики применяют свое знание направления и технологическую ощущение для поиска возможных уязвимостей в приложении.

Программное испытание продуктивно для контроля повторяющихся вариантов, возвратного испытания и проверки больших объемов информации. Механизированные испытания могут исполняться непрерывно, не предполагают вовлечения оператора и обеспечивают стабильные выводы контроля.

Модульное тестирование контролирует отдельные элементы программы Драгон мани в изоляции от прочей структуры. Кодеры формируют проверки для своего кода, которые активируются при любом корректировке и помогают моментально находить проблемы на уровне отдельных функций или классов.

Объединительное проверка фокусируется на тестировании контакта между различными элементами и компонентами программы. Оно способствует найти неполадки в взаимодействиях, пересылке информации между частями и совокупной структуре решения.

Какими методами выявляют баги на различных стадиях программирования

На этапе планирования и создания неточности находятся через анализ системных требований, исследование структурных подходов и симуляцию потребительских ситуаций. Профессионалы отличающихся направлений исследуют бумаги, выявляют вероятные проблемы и рекомендуют оптимизации до инициирования деятельной создания.

Во время разработки скрипта программисты применяют неподвижный анализ программирования, который автоматически проверяет систему Dragon Money на согласованность нормам программирования, вероятные слабости секьюрности и обычные ошибки программирования. Актуальные совмещенные платформы разработки имеют инструменты, которые подсвечивают неполадки непосредственно в деятельности разработки кода.

Просмотр кода представляет собой процесс взаимной анализа кода кодерами. Коллеги исследуют написанный код с позиции понятности деятельности, соответствия правилам коллектива, возможных проблем эффективности и шансов для улучшения. Этот ход не только помогает найти баги, но и способствует обмену знаниями в группе.

Активное тестирование исполняется на действующей программе и включает различные виды рабочего и нефункционального испытания. Специалисты стартуют приложение с разными входными данными, тестируют функционирование в крайних условиях и исследуют итоги реализации.

Почему необходимо контролировать защищенность и защиту материалов

Защищенность цифровых продуктов Драгон мани становится жизненно необходимым аспектом стандарта в время компьютеризации и растущих цифровых опасностей. Взломы секьюрности могут привести не только к экономическим убыткам, но и к критическому ущербу имиджу фирмы, утрате доверия покупателей и юридическим результатам.

Контроль секьюрности содержит контроль идентификации и авторизации юзеров, защиты от ключевых типов угроз, подобно внедрения запросов, XSS и фальсификация междоменных требований. Специалисты по безопасности анализируют построение программы с перспективы вероятных опасностей и контролируют эффективность внедренных оборонительных систем.

Охрана личных информации нуждается повышенного концентрации в связи с усилением законодательства в сфере секретности. Приложения должны адекватно работать, содержать и пересылать конфиденциальную информацию, предоставлять возможность уничтожения данных по требованию юзеров и соблюдать основы уменьшения сбора данных.

Криптографическая охрана материалов Драгон мани казино тестируется на тему задействования актуальных методов шифрования, корректной реализации протоколов безопасности и корректного регулирования паролями. Проблемные зоны в шифровании могут превратить всю механизм защиты малорезультативной.

Как контролируют темп, нагружение и стабильность

Эффективность софта тестируется через систему стрессовых испытаний, которые моделируют многочисленные случаи использования программы в действительных условиях. Загрузочное испытание определяет, как приложение ведет себя при ожидаемом объеме юзеров и операций.

Стрессовое тестирование помогает найти момент сбоя приложения, поэтапно наращивая нагрузку до предельных значений. Это дает возможность понять лимиты потенциала приложения и контролировать, насколько адекватно она деградирует при избыточном напряжении.

Проверка устойчивости включает долгосрочные проверки работы приложения Dragon Money под стабильной напряжением для обнаружения утечек данных, поэтапного падения быстродействия и других проблем, которые проявляются только при длительной деятельности.

Мониторинг быстродействия во время проверки охватывает контроль использования CPU, оперативной памяти, хранилища и коммуникационных возможностей. Эти параметры содействуют обнаружить ограничения в построении и оптимизировать быстродействие приложения.

Что выполняют, если дефект найдена перед выпуском

Выявление бага перед запуском продукта инициирует процесс изучения важности сложности и принятия определения о последующих действиях. Важные ошибки, которые могут вызвать к потере материалов, компрометации безопасности или абсолютной неработоспособности системы, нуждаются экстренного исправления.

Методология управления дефектами охватывает подробное оформление выявленной неполадки с отметкой шагов для повторения, условий, в котором выражается ошибка, и ожидаемого функционирования приложения. Отдел программирования анализирует дефект, определяет основание и составляет планы исправление.

Ранжирование исправлений основывается на эффекте дефекта на пользователей Драгон мани казино, периодичности ее демонстрации и комплексности устранения. Определенные малые сложности могут быть отложены до последующего запуска, если их коррекция предполагает значительных модификаций в программе.

После исправления ошибки выполняется верификационное испытание, которое подтверждает, что проблема устранена, а также повторное испытание для контроля того, что коррекция не повлекло к появлению новых багов в других элементах программы.